Abstract EN

-Introduction Rheumatoid arthritis (RA) is not generally considered a risk factor for venous thromboembolism.

Case presentation A patient with RA and postmenopausal osteoporosis was reported with massive pulmonary embolism following treatment with raloxifene for 3 months.

This patient met the American College of Rheumatology ( ACR) criteria for RA diagnosis in 1988.

She was controlled on regular disease modifying antirheumatic drug (DMARDs) for 4 years.

Conclusion Pulmonary embolism in postmenopausal osteoporotic patient with RA could be due to raloxifene treatment rather than a complication of the disease itself.
